Court tells Klarna to pay $733,000 over GDPR failings

Klarna must pay a fine of nearly three quarters of a million dollars for violating the EU's General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R), a Swedish court of appeal has ruled.

Banks to be given more time to investigate APP fraud

UK banks will be given an extra 72 hours to stall payments if they suspect authorised push payment fraud.
